Alterations in neural circuits underlying emotion regulation following child maltreatment: a mechanism underlying trauma-related psychopathology

Jessica L. Jenness et al.

Summary: The study found that maltreated youth showed different patterns of brain activation compared to non-maltreated youth when facing negative emotional stimuli, with reduced activation in cognitive control regions and increased activation in regions associated with emotion processing. These alterations in brain function partly explain the association between maltreatment and psychopathology.
